Why is THRIVE Pain Skills Group beneficial?

THRIVE Pain Skills Group is a supportive, practical group for anyone living with ongoing pain, tension, headaches, fatigue, or movement fear. This group focuses on building real-life tools rather than chasing a cure, helping participants develop the confidence and clarity needed to live well even when symptoms persist.

Who should participate in THRIVE Pain Skills Group?

THRIVE Pain Skills Group is appropriate for adults with chronic musculoskeletal pain, headaches, sensitization-type symptoms, post-injury or post-surgical pain, or anyone feeling stuck in a cycle of pain and avoidance.

If you’re looking for a grounded, evidence-based way to understand your pain and move forward with more confidence and ease, THRIVE offers a welcoming place to begin.

What should I expect during THRIVE Pain Skills Group?

Led by a physical therapist trained in pain neuroscience and psychologically informed approaches, THRIVE Pain Skills Group blends simple education, gentle movement, and mind-body strategies that calm an overprotective nervous system. Each session offers:

  • Insight into how pain works and why it can become amplified
  • Skills for regulating stress, pacing activity, and returning to valued movement
  • Support and validation through guided group discussion
  • Empowerment to make small, meaningful changes that improve daily life
Participants learn to shift unhelpful pain patterns, reduce fear and frustration, and build habits that support resilience and well-being.
